AIMS: The present study aims to investigate the implications of web-based delivery of identical learning content for time efficiency and students' performance, as compared to conventional textbook resources. MATERIALS AND METHODS: Two cohorts of third year undergraduate dental students in 2003 (n = 35) and 2006 (n = 32) completed the study. Following a baseline pre-test, the students were divided into two groups and given 3 weeks for studying identical content using a web-based application (group A) or a conventional paper manuscript (group B). Post-test, end of semester examination and a final retention test were taken. Test scores and studying time was registered for both cohorts in 2003 and 2006. RESULTS: Group A and B knowledge gain was highly significant between the average per cent scores from pre-test, post-test and end of semester examination in both cohorts in 2003 and 2006 (P < 0.005). Group A spent 1.6× (2003) to 2.6× (2006) less time studying than group B. The average total studying time recorded for group B was 5.1 h using 6.2 learning sessions in 2003 and 3.5 h using 4.4 sessions in 2006. With group A, significantly less time was measured for studying through web-based content using an average of 2.5 h over 4.4 learning sessions in 2003 and 1.5 h added over three sessions in 2006. CONCLUSIONS: Web-based delivery of identical content results in less overall studying time as compared to textbook delivery. These results appear independent of the students' own preference of the learning medium.

The examination of the urine is of great significance in medical diagnostics. This can be seen in the high number of ordered urin analyses. Accordingly, the interpretation of urinalysis is part of the Swiss Catalogue of Learning Objectives of Undergraduate Medical Training as well as the licencing examinations in Internal Medicine. Due to its simple handling, its low costs and the many parameters measured, the chemical urinalysis with a stix is an ideal screening test. In contrast to stix tests, the interpretation of urine sediments is far from being trivial. The examiners must be accordingly trained in order to recognize the typical abnormalities of the urine sediment. Learning how to interpret microscopic findings is tedious and time-consuming if technical aids such as a microscope-mounted video camera are lacking. An additional handicap is that urine sediments can not be kept for a long time as it is the case with blood smears. Therefore an interactive learning program such as UroSurf offers many possibilities to lessen these problems. UroSurf is a web-based learning program consisting of three modules. In the module "Urindiagnostik", urine diagnostics are presented in a textbook like style. In the module "Klinische Fallbeispiele" (clinical case samples), urine diagnostics are put into a clinical context. In the module "Urinsediment-Bilder" (images), learners can train and assess their skills in interpreting urine sediments.

Microscopic examination of blood films is essential in clinical medicine despite automatic cell counters. To acquire this skill takes time, an adequate technical infrastructure and experienced instructors. In many cases all these things are not readily available. A computer-based learning program such as "HemoSurf" helps to supply these needs. In its learning part, "HemoSurf" allows the user to develop pattern recognition by offering more than 2000 images of blood and bone marrow films. In a stepwise manner the learner is enabled to differentiate leukocytes and recognize qualitative alterations to blood cells. In the reference part the user can look up blood films and some of the corresponding bone marrow films of over 30 diseases. Recombinant human granulocyte colony-stimulating factor (rhG-CSF) has been used mainly for treatment of chemotherapy-induced neutropenia. The reported side effects were of minor importance. We describe a case of long-term treatment with rhG-CSF, in which we observed enhanced bone remodeling.
